Types of Fire Suppression Systems

  1. Water-Based Systems:

    • Wet Pipe Systems: These are the most common type, where water is stored under pressure in pipes and released immediately when a fire is detected.
    • Dry Pipe Systems: Suitable for areas prone to freezing, these systems hold pressurized air instead of water in the pipes, which is released first to allow water flow after detection.
  2. Gaseous Fire Suppression Systems:

    • Clean Agent Systems: Utilize inert gases or chemical agents that suppress fires without leaving residue, making them ideal for protecting sensitive equipment and spaces like data centers.
    • CO2 Systems: Carbon dioxide is discharged to reduce oxygen levels, extinguishing fires quickly. They are effective in enclosed areas but require careful handling due to their potential for asphyxiation.
  3. Foam-Based Systems:

    • Foam-Water Sprinkler Systems: Combine water and foam concentrate to form a foam blanket that suppresses flammable liquid fires. Commonly used in industries handling combustible materials.
    • Foam-Water Spray Systems: Similar to foam-water sprinkler systems but with a different discharge pattern, ideal for high-risk areas like aircraft hangars.
  4. Powder-Based Systems:

    • Dry Chemical Systems: Use dry chemical agents like ABC powder to extinguish fires by interrupting the chemical reaction. They are versatile and effective against different types of fires, including flammable liquids and electrical fires.
    • Dry Powder Systems: Employ specially formulated powders like sodium bicarbonate or potassium bicarbonate to suppress fires. These are suitable for environments where electrical equipment is present.
  5. Special Hazard Fire Suppression Systems:

    • Kitchen Fire Suppression Systems: Designed specifically for commercial kitchens, these systems quickly extinguish grease fires and prevent re-ignition.
    • Vehicle Fire Suppression Systems: Installed in vehicles carrying flammable materials or in industrial vehicles like forklifts, these systems protect against fires in confined spaces.

Components of Fire Suppression Systems

Each type of fire suppression system comprises specific components essential for its operation:

  • Detection System: Utilizes smoke detectors, heat detectors, or flame detectors to sense the presence of fire.
  • Control Panel: Centralizes the operation of the system, receiving signals from detectors and initiating the release of suppression agents.
  • Suppression Agent Storage: Contains the suppression agent (e.g., water, gas, foam) in designated tanks or cylinders.
  • Distribution Piping: Delivers the suppression agent to the protected area, ensuring thorough coverage.
  • Release Mechanism: Initiates the discharge of the suppression agent upon detection of a fire.

Applications of Fire Suppression Systems

The choice of fire suppression system depends on the specific hazards and requirements of the environment:

  • Residential Buildings: Typically equipped with wet pipe sprinkler systems to provide immediate water-based suppression in case of fire.
  • Commercial Spaces: Utilize a range of systems based on the type of business and fire risks, such as clean agent systems for offices and dry chemical systems for warehouses.
  • Industrial Facilities: Employ diverse systems tailored to the unique hazards present, including foam-based systems for flammable liquid storage areas and CO2 systems for electrical rooms.
  • Specialized Environments: Require custom-designed systems like kitchen fire suppression systems for restaurants and vehicle fire suppression systems for transportation vehicles.

Maintenance and Compliance

Regular maintenance and compliance with regulatory standards are essential for ensuring the effectiveness of fire suppression systems:

  • Inspections: Conducted periodically to check the functionality of detectors, control panels, and suppression agents.
  • Testing: Involves simulated activations to verify the system's response and readiness.
  • Compliance: Adhering to local fire codes and standards ensures that the system meets safety requirements and operational guidelines.
